A Refreshing Break: The Perceived Advantages of Soda

Despite its documented health risks, soda has maintained its popularity for several reasons that offer immediate, though often fleeting, gratification. From a consumer perspective, the advantages are primarily linked to taste, convenience, and a perceived energy boost.

Convenience and Accessibility

Soda is readily available in a vast array of flavors and packaging, making it a convenient choice for a quick refreshment on the go. This accessibility is a major factor in its widespread consumption across various demographics and regions. In areas where clean drinking water might be a concern, a sealed bottle of soda offers a safe, if nutritionally void, liquid for hydration.

Temporary Energy and Mood Enhancement

Many sodas contain caffeine and high levels of sugar, which provide a temporary boost in energy and can help with concentration. While this effect is short-lived and is often followed by a sugar crash, it's a key reason people turn to soda during a midday slump or when needing a quick pick-me-up. There's also the psychological factor; for some, the effervescence and flavor simply provide a momentary pleasure or serve as a satisfying treat.

Aiding Digestion

While not medically recommended, some people find that drinking a flat soda can help soothe an upset stomach or aid in digestion. In rare cases, medical professionals have even used cola to treat gastric phytobezoars, or stomach blockages. However, this is not a general health benefit but rather a specific, unusual application.

A Cascade of Consequences: The Significant Disadvantages of Soda

Beyond the fleeting benefits, the disadvantages of soda, particularly regular, sugar-sweetened varieties, are extensive and scientifically well-documented. These risks affect multiple bodily systems and often have long-term consequences.

Oral Health Degradation

One of the most immediate and visible negative impacts of soda is on oral health. The high sugar content provides fuel for oral bacteria, which produce acids that erode tooth enamel and lead to decay. This is compounded by the fact that many sodas are already highly acidic, with the carbonic and phosphoric acids directly attacking the teeth. Over time, this double-edged acid assault can lead to cavities and gum disease.

Weight Gain and Metabolic Disorders

Regular soda consumption is strongly linked to weight gain, obesity, and metabolic syndrome. The calories from sugary drinks do not induce the same feeling of fullness as solid food, leading people to consume more calories overall. Excess sugar is also converted into fat by the liver, contributing to non-alcoholic fatty liver disease and increasing triglyceride levels. This can raise the risk of developing type 2 diabetes and heart disease.

Compromised Bone and Kidney Health

Certain sodas, especially cola-based drinks, contain phosphoric acid. High intake of phosphoric acid can lead to lower bone mineral density, particularly in women, as it can interfere with calcium absorption. Furthermore, studies have shown a link between daily cola consumption and an increased risk of chronic kidney disease and kidney stone formation.

Risks Associated with Diet Soda

Diet soda is often marketed as a healthier alternative, but it presents its own set of concerns. The artificial sweeteners used, like aspartame, have been linked in some studies to altered gut microbiota, which can impact metabolic health. Some research also suggests a potential link between diet soda and an increased risk of stroke and dementia. Artificial sweeteners may also increase appetite for high-calorie foods, potentially hindering weight management efforts.

Comparison of Regular vs. Diet Soda

Feature Regular Soda (Sugar-Sweetened) Diet Soda (Artificially Sweetened)
Calories High (around 140 calories per 12oz can). Zero or near-zero.
Sweetener High fructose corn syrup, sucrose, etc.. Artificial sweeteners like aspartame, sucralose.
Impact on Weight Strong evidence linking consumption to weight gain and obesity. Conflicting evidence; may increase appetite and has been linked to weight gain.
Diabetes Risk Significantly increases risk of type 2 diabetes. Some studies show an increased risk of metabolic dysfunction, including diabetes.
Dental Health High sugar and acidity lead to tooth decay and erosion. High acidity can cause enamel erosion; some flavored sparkling waters can also be erosive.
Heart Health Increases risk of heart disease due to effects on weight and cholesterol. Some studies suggest potential links to heart and brain issues.

The Economic and Environmental Impact

Beyond the personal health consequences, the production and disposal of soda have broader economic and environmental implications. The heavy water and energy usage in manufacturing, combined with the waste from plastic bottles and aluminum cans, contribute to environmental degradation. From an economic standpoint, the healthcare costs associated with treating the chronic conditions linked to excessive soda consumption place a significant burden on public health systems. Potential for Fortified and Healthier Options

It is worth noting that not all carbonated drinks are created equal. The market for sparkling waters and other carbonated beverages without added sugars or artificial sweeteners offers a healthier alternative for those who enjoy the fizz. Some beverages are even fortified with vitamins and minerals, offering some nutritional value. However, consumers must be vigilant in reading labels to distinguish these healthier options from traditional sodas laden with sugar and other additives. This evolving market suggests that the future of carbonated beverages could shift towards more health-conscious options, but this does not negate the known disadvantages of traditional soda.
